From c5eb5b93993a7551d8d4dec50d5f51177cba5e97 Mon Sep 17 00:00:00 2001 From: yumoqing Date: Fri, 12 Jun 2026 15:32:27 +0800 Subject: [PATCH] =?UTF-8?q?fix:=20get=5Fpricing=5Fdisplay=20=E5=BC=82?= =?UTF-8?q?=E5=B8=B8=E4=BF=9D=E6=8A=A4=EF=BC=8C=E8=BF=94=E5=9B=9ENone?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- pricing/pricing.py |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/pricing/pricing.py b/pricing/pricing.py index 06cbe16..0188bee 100644 --- a/pricing/pricing.py +++ b/pricing/pricing.py @@ -793,7 +793,10 @@ async def get_pricing_display(ppid): ] } """ - r = await PricingProgram.get_ppid_pricing(ppid) + try: + r = await PricingProgram.get_ppid_pricing(ppid) + except Exception: + return None pricing_data_str = r.pricing_data d = yaml.safe_load(pricing_data_str) if not d: